While we were waiting for Ruby Mei we documented what we did each month here. If you are waiting now for your referral, even if it is a longs way off, I encourage you to do the same. Thanks to a Beth Moore book I was reading at the time, and the study of Genesis I was in at BSF, I tried to be more aware of the "God Moments" and the blessings in my/our life while we waited. Recording these caused me to pause each month and reflect on our life as a family of three.
As we approach the one year anniversary of our referral on March 5th I find my mind going back to the way God orchestrated our adoption so perfectly. I love to look back on our monthly journals to see what we were doing. I think about the way I prayed for Ruby Mei, and for Ainsley's relationship with her. God was so faithful in the way he answered.
This past weekend I watched as Ruby followed Ainsley around. How she backed into her to sit on her lap, danced with her, laughed with her and overall just how much they have come to love each other. It really is amazing to sit back and watch.

Hi Everyone,
Just a quick update on Madison. She needs our prayers for healing!
They were hoping to remove her chest tubes and take her off of the ventilator today. Unfortunately she is still retaining too much fluid around her lungs for this to take place. They will try again tomorrow. But, the sweet little thing has to go through medication transitions each time they attempt to see if she is ready for the next step. This causes her to be more awake and then of course more aware of how un-comfortable she is. Due to the ventilator she can't cry, but you can see her dis-comfort and see her vital signs change... Unfortunately because of all of the tubes, etc. right now Julie and Todd can only comfort her by being close by and talking to her.... Of course they want to hold her close, but it is just not possible right now.... Julie and Todd are showing so much strength!
I ask for prayers for Maddie's lungs to clear quickly so she can get the respirator OUT! And, of course for when that happens that she will continue to breathe easily on her own. Lastly, for her pain to be tolerable. They have warned Julie & Todd that due to the way her blood is now flowing (re-routed in surgery) she is going to be pretty miserable (migraine like headaches) for a few weeks. I am just praying for miracle pain free healing for the little peanut!!

Last night Jeff and I volunteered at the Stephen Curtis Chapman Concert for America World. Our role was to help collect "change" for his "Show Hope" ministry which raises money to help orphans around the world. Our team helped Stephen raise almost $12,000 last night! With these funds he will be able to offer grants of up to $3000-$4000 for families who are in the process of adoption. He gifted a family last night with $4000 for their pending adoption. It was awesome to be a part of it! And, a reminder of how blessed Jeff and I feel to be part of the adoption community! Here is also the link to our Adoption Agency. China Orphans NEED our help now!!!! Please read!

Most of you are probably aware that China is experiencing some of the worst weather in history all over the country right now. Provinces that are not used to cold weather are dealing with severe temperatures, snow, and ice! In these provinces are orphanages with precious children like Ruby Mei waiting to be placed with their forever families around the world! These orphanages need our help to get mainly space heaters, blankets, food and diapers for the children immediately! Some of these facilities go through more than 750 diapers a day!!!! Half the Sky, is an amazing United States organization that has been helping China Orphans for 10 years. Their Executive Director, Jenny Bowen has sent out a plea for funds. They have set up and Emergency Fund called Little Mouse. You can go there today and donate! Please help us take care of these precious children and their loving care givers!
